PSCI-LIA, a fast-growing 8(a), SDVOSB, and woman-owned small business, is seeking a Project Manager for an upcoming contract.

Position Summary:

The Project Manager is the single point of accountability for daily performance of USTDA's Information Resource Center (IRC) Administrative Support Services contract. The PM has full authority to act for the contractor on all contract matters, supervises 7 SCA-covered IRC staff on-site at USTDA's Arlington office, owns the Quality Control Plan, manages the Phase-In Plan within 40 calendar days of award, leads recurring meetings with the CO/COR, and ensures continuous compliance with USTDA, FAR, DD-254, NARA, FOIA, and Service Contract Act requirements.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Serve as Key Personnel and primary on-site liaison to the USTDA Contracting Officer (CO) and Contracting Officer's Representative (COR).
  • Lead day-to-day operations of the IRC including records management, FOIA/Privacy Act support, administrative support, reception, mailroom, conference/AV support, and project information services.
  • Develop, submit, and execute the Phase-In Plan within 10 calendar days of award and assume full operational responsibility within 40 calendar days (PWS D.1.17).
  • Author and maintain the Quality Control Plan (due 20 calendar days after award) and report on QC metrics per PWS D.1.12.
  • Supervise, mentor, and evaluate 7 SCA-covered IRC staff; oversee cross-training, scheduling, leave coverage, and workload balancing.
  • Plan, schedule, budget, and report on all contract deliverables (e.g., IRC Manual, training plan, annual NARA Records Management Self-Assessment data).
  • Manage personnel substitutions per PWS D.1.10.4 (15-day advance written notice with substitute resume).
  • Provide on-site technical support and AV troubleshooting during executive events when needed.
  • Maintain GFE inventory and the government-issued mobile phone for official business only.
  • Ensure all staff hold and maintain SECRET clearances and FACs; coordinate with Facility Security Officer (FSO) on DCSA filings.
